The three also pledged to strengthen maritime security across the Indo-Pacific region, including Southeast Asia. North Korea appears to have skipped the ARF for the second consecutive year, Seoul officials said, as it continues to focus on bilateral diplomacy with Russia and China while shunning multilateral diplomatic engagements. During Wednesday’s meeting, the three ministris also welcomed the expansion of trilateral cooperation into areas such as combating transnational crime, disaster relief and humanitarian assistance, according to the ministry.
